He sponsored the translation of the King James Version of the Bible that was released in 1611. His team of translators got right what is in the first Line of Genesis 3:16.
They showed that God took action in two ways. One action was linked down to the man in verse 17. One action was linked back up to the serpent-tempter in verse 15.
According to the King James Version (KJV) God promised:
I will multiply your (1) sorrow and (2) your conception.
Translations in English for hundreds of years after the KJV got Line 1 right as well. But in 1952 translators started getting it wrong with the RSV (Revised Standard Version). Later versions followed the example of the RSV.
Modern versions make it look like God did one thing. And that was very harsh.
I will multiply your pain-in-childbirth!
